This is more than a first job - it's the foundation for a long-term leadership career.

As part of our Manufacturing & Operations Leadership Development Program, you'll develop a strong operational mindset, work side by side with experienced leaders, and gain handson exposure to largescale manufacturing environments.

Designed specifically for new graduates, this structured 18month rotational program provides immersive learning across key operational areas and prepares you to become one of the future leaders within our network.

What's involved in this role:

As an Associate in our Manufacturing & Operations Leadership Development Program, through structured rotations, mentorship, and leadership coaching, you will gain the technical, operational, and people-management skills needed to lead teams in a high-performance manufacturing environment. You will rotate through several key operational functions including:

  • Production & operations

  • Maintenance & automation

  • Planning & distribution

  • Quality & Food safety

  • Continuous improvements

During the program, you will:

  • Work directly in production environments, supporting process optimization and taking on early teamcoordination responsibilities.

  • Follow a personalized development plan supported by mentorship, coaching, and leadership workshops.

  • Collaborate with cross functional teams and gain visibility with senior leaders.

  • Be considered for a frontline leadership or supervisory role upon successful completion.

You will learn:

  • How to build foundational leadership and peoplemanagement skills.

  • How manufacturing operations and production processes function from end to end.

  • Key principles of Lean manufacturing, continuous improvement, and root cause analysis.

  • How supply chain planning, scheduling, and workflow optimization drive operational success.

  • How to make data driven decisions using performance metrics and operational insights.

What you need to join our team:

  • Bachelor's degree in Dairy Manufacturing, Food Science, Production & Operations Management, Industrial Technology, or a related technical or business field

  • Internship or relevant project experience in manufacturing, operations, or industrial technology (preferred)

  • Demonstrated leadership through internships, campus involvement, or team projects

  • Strong communication, analytical, and problemsolving skills

  • Mobility to relocate for assignments (if required)

  • Genuine interest in leading teams in a manufacturing environment
